Hot Die Steel H11 Dealer In Delhi Hot Die Steel H11 is a popular tool steel known for its excellent combination of toughness, heat resistance, and wear resistance, making it ideal for high-stress applications. It belongs to the chromium-based family of hot work steels, commonly used in die-casting, forging, and extrusion industries. Composition and Properties H11 steel is characterized by its balanced composition of carbon, chromium, molybdenum, and vanadium, with chromium being the primary alloying element. This composition gives H11 steel its notable properties: Toughness: H11 steel has excellent toughness, which allows it to withstand the repeated impact and stress encountered in hot working processes without cracking or deforming. Heat Resistance: The steel maintains its strength and hardness at elevated temperatures, making it suitable for applications that involve prolonged exposure to high heat. It can operate at temperatures up to 550°C (1022°F) without losing its mechanical properties. Wear Resistance: H11 has good wear resistance, which is essential for tools that come into contact with other hard materials under pressure, such as dies and molds in forging or extrusion. Applications H11 is widely used in the manufacturing of tools that must endure high thermal and mechanical stresses. Common applications include: Die-Casting Dies: H11 steel is ideal for creating dies used in the die-casting of aluminum, zinc, and other metals, where the dies must resist cracking and wear over many cycles. Forging Dies: It is used to manufacture forging dies that can withstand the high pressures and temperatures involved in shaping metals. Extrusion Tools: H11 is also employed in the production of extrusion dies and tools, which require high durability and resistance to thermal fatigue. Advantages The main advantage of H11 steel is its ability to perform reliably under extreme conditions, combining toughness, heat resistance, and wear resistance. This makes it a preferred material for tools and components exposed to both high temperatures and mechanical stress. H11 also offers good machinability and can be hardened and tempered to achieve the desired balance of strength and toughness.
